The Realm of Magnitude Representations: Origins and Neural Basis – NUMSPA
The ability to discriminate and represent information of magnitude is foundational to human reasoning. A related fundamental cognitive ability is the propensity to use spatial information in order to represent other non-spatial concepts. Among the many mappings between different dimensions that humans can establish, the number-space mapping is essential for human cognition.

TRACE METAL LEGACY on MOUNTAIN AQUATIC ECOGEOCHEMISTRY – TRAM
Following the onset of the industrial revolution and the use of fossil energy, humans can now indisputably be seen as major geological agents. At present, anthropogenic fluxes of up to 62 chemical elements surpass their corresponding natural fluxes. Due to their geological features mountain environments have been exploited since the beginning of metallurgy.

Solar cells using lead-free hybrid perovskites – SuperSansPlomb
The main goal of the project is to develop lead-free perovskite-type absorber materials, and to integrate them into solar cells showing high efficiency and stability.

Small islands addressing climate change: towards storylines of risk and adaptation – STORISK
This 48-month project develops an integrated approach to climate-related risks (i.e., coastal erosion, marine inundation and reef mortality) in French overseas territories under climate change. It will generate an innovative transdisciplinary protocol and practice-oriented knowledge, including a didactic<br />explanation of the processes going from hazards to impacts and vulnerability, and the highlighting of the most promising ways to enhance adaptation to climate change.
